Neutrino oscillation effect on the indirect signal of neutralino dark matter from the Earth core

We investigate the effect induced by neutrino oscillation on the dark matter indirect detection signal which consists in a muon neutrino flux produced by neutralino annihilation in the Earth core. We consider the neutrino oscillation parameters relevant to the atmosferic neutrino deficit, both in the nu_mu -> nu_tau and nu_mu -> nu_s cases.
